Drumroll please...
In Illinois, you can collect unemployment benefits for a maximum of 26 glorious weeks. That's a solid half-year of Netflix binging, park hangs, and perfecting your sourdough starter (because, let's be honest, everyone tried that in 2020).

But Wait, There's More! (Because Adulting Never Lets You Catch a Break)
This 26-week figure isn't set in stone. It depends on when you filed your claim. There's also this whole thing about the unemployment rate in Illinois. Basically, the higher the unemployment rate, the longer you might be able to collect benefits. Think of it as a cosmic high-five for surviving a tough job market.

Because Free Money Doesn't Come Easy (But It Shouldn't Be Hard Either)

There are some hoops to jump through to claim those sweet unemployment benefits. You'll need to prove you lost your job through no fault of your own, actively search for new work, and be willing to accept suitable employment (no, that dream job as a professional napper probably won't cut it).
